Understanding the Beast: What is Social Anxiety?
Before we explore Hitomi-Chan's secrets, let's clarify what social anxiety truly is. It's more than just shyness; it's a persistent and overwhelming fear of social situations. This fear can lead to physical symptoms like sweating, trembling, and nausea, and significantly impact daily life. Hitomi-Chan's Three Pillars of Social Confidence
Hitomi-Chan's success boils down to three core pillars:
1. Self-Compassion and Self-Acceptance
This is perhaps the most crucial element. Hitomi-Chan realized that self-criticism only amplified her anxiety. Instead, she practiced self-compassion, treating herself with the same kindness and understanding she would offer a friend struggling with the same issue. This involved:
- Positive self-talk: Replacing negative thoughts ("I'm going to mess this up") with positive affirmations ("I can handle this; I'm capable").
- Mindfulness: Focusing on the present moment rather than dwelling on past mistakes or worrying about the future.
- Self-care: Prioritizing activities that bring her joy and relaxation, such as yoga, meditation, or spending time in nature.
2. Gradual Exposure Therapy
Hitomi-Chan didn't attempt to conquer her anxiety overnight. Instead, she employed gradual exposure therapy, a technique that involves slowly and systematically facing her fears. She started with small, manageable steps, like smiling at strangers or making brief eye contact. As her confidence grew, she gradually took on more challenging social interactions. This approach is key to building resilience and reducing the intensity of anxiety over time.
3. Building Genuine Connections
Hitomi-Chan understood that social anxiety isn't just about avoiding situations; it's also about fostering genuine connections. She actively sought out opportunities to interact with people who shared her interests. This involved joining clubs, attending workshops, and engaging in online communities. These experiences helped her build her confidence and create a supportive network.
Maintaining Progress: Long-Term Strategies
Conquering social anxiety is an ongoing process, not a destination. Hitomi-Chan emphasizes the importance of continued self-care and maintaining healthy coping mechanisms. This includes:
- Regular practice of self-compassion techniques.
- Continuously challenging herself with new social situations.
- Seeking professional support when needed. A therapist can provide valuable guidance and support.
